Check out Franklinton, EAST of 315. Shady, but you can be sure that's the next area to blow up with COSI being rebuilt and 400 W. Rich/Land Grant Brewing adding a lot of buzz to that area.

 

Other than that, be prepared to go condo. You can get garages, but working on your junk may be difficult. I know a couple of car guys (single) living downtown but neither does more than car washing at their places...no real room to store major tools and don't want to draw attention from peeps walking around downtown.

 

I applaud you for this. There are certainly compromises, but Ohio is a great state population-wise to get a true downtown-living experience yet still have relative ease getting around. I just came back from Christmas in Philadelphia with family (been doing it for years) and while a neat city, you'd need to be a millionaire to live well downtown, or you're in some sh!tty neighborhoods for miles just to get by.
